8,647,828 is a composite number, even.
8,647,828 (eight million six hundred forty-seven thousand eight hundred twenty-eight) is an even 7-digit number. It is a composite number with 12 divisors, and factors as 2² × 7 × 308,851. Its proper divisors sum to 8,647,884, more than the number itself, making it an abundant number.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x83F494.
